Jandor Rejects Tinubu’s Alleged Backing of Hamzat for 2027 Lagos Governorship

Lagos APC aspirant Jandor says Tinubu has not endorsed any candidate and insists the 2027 governorship race is still wide open.

Abdulazeez Adediran, popularly known as Jandor, has dismissed reports suggesting that Bola Tinubu has endorsed Obafemi Hamzat for the 2027 Lagos State governorship election.

The former PDP governorship candidate, now an aspirant under the APC, said there has been no official endorsement and noted that Hamzat has yet to publicly declare his intention to run.

Speaking on Channels Television’s Politics Today, Jandor challenged the narrative that the race had already been decided.

“He hasn’t even said to us himself that he is running. He is the deputy governor of Lagos, qualified, with over 20 years of experience in that space.”

He further dismissed claims of presidential endorsement:

“No, the President hasn’t endorsed anyone. I am an aspirant, and we are a few people also gunning for this. We will be the first set of people to know if there is anything like that because communication will come.”

Jandor emphasised that the APC has not adopted a consensus candidate, stating that the party is preparing for direct primaries.

“As we speak, the party says it’s going to be direct primaries. If tomorrow it says this is what we are doing, we will fall in line. The party is supreme.”

He revealed that his meeting with President Tinubu did not include any promise of support or discouragement, reinforcing his resolve to stay in the race.

On his early ambition, he said:

“Absolutely, because if you don’t believe in yourself, nobody will believe in you. When the President was running for the ticket, he came out to say he wanted to run.”

Jandor also maintained that the APC’s dominance in Lagos has weakened opposition parties but reaffirmed his commitment to support whoever emerges as the party’s candidate.

With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u nearing the end of his second term, interest in the 2027 race continues to grow, with several prominent figures reportedly considering a run.
